A fixed gear having 100 teeth meshes with another gear having 25 teeth, the centre lines of both the gears being joined by an arm so as to form an epicyclic gear train. The number of rotations made by the smaller gear for one rotation of the arm is Correct Answer 5

Revolution of 25 teeth gear = 1 + T100/T25 = 1 + 100/25 =5.
